Output dd3e77dfdcfd3dc88fe094909901ee5d2b0e24f43c83ade0897d81907ff0e07c:0

value
406763796
script pubkey
OP_0 OP_PUSHBYTES_20 4da0f53c425f49ab955ce5ab2126ce745edd787a
address
tb1qfks020zztay6h92uuk4jzfkww30d67r6yqnfa3
transaction
dd3e77dfdcfd3dc88fe094909901ee5d2b0e24f43c83ade0897d81907ff0e07c
confirmations
115054
spent
true